One of the core components of Bee City USA and Bee Campus USA (BCUSA) is having a quality integrated pest management (IPM) plan that emphasizes pesticide reduction and pollinator health. To help, this fall we’re excited to launch a new IPM Plan Toolkit to guide affiliates as they create or improve their IPM plans.

Bee City USA and Bee Campus USA are initiatives of the Xerces Society.


The Xerces Society is a donor-supported nonprofit organization that protects our world through the conservation of invertebrates and their habitats.
